CLAIM: California law prohibits jails from turning people over to federal immigration authorities.
Fact
FACT: California law does not prohibit jails from turning over people convicted of felonies or serious misdemeanors to federal immigration authorities.

False Claim: California is unsafe
Preliminary 2024 data shows violent crime in California cities declined 8.3%, compared to a 5.5% decline in non-California US cities.


Stealing under $950 is NOT legal in California
The felony threshold of $950 was not changed under Prop 36, which recently passed in California.
